Nick Lane is Professor of Evolutionary Biochemistry at University College London. His research is on how energy flow has shaped evolution, from the origin of life to the evolution of eukaryotic cells with downright quirky traits such as sex. The Earth teems with life: in its oceans, forests, skies and cities. Yet there is a black hole at the heart of biology. We do not know why complex life is the way it is, or, for that matter, how life first began. In this talk Lane will show that the answer lies in energy!
